dc.description.abstract | In line with the goals of the Capital Maintenance doctrine, financial assistance law aims at protecting shareholders and creditors by imposing restrictions on the company, disallowing such companies to provide financial assistance to third parties with the aim of such third parties acquiring shares in the same company or in its parent. This study aims at tackling the question of the validity and effectiveness of such prohibition. Being heavily influenced by UK law, the study finds it basis in the analysis of UK law however; it is then given a European and Maltese dimension. The first chapter consists of a brief outline of the history of the ban from its introduction in the UK in the 1920's up to the latest amended Second Company Law Directive. The Second Chapter consists of a detailed analysis of the legal provisions. Chapter two further includes a comparative study of the ban in the UK, in Malta and on a European level. This includes a textual comparison with case law. The study then moves on to a detailed discussion regarding the rationale of the ban. The UK and European view are discussed in detail and Chapter 3 also includes general observations in terms of modem company law. The final chapter concludes the study, by analysing the current situation in Malta. Chapter 4 included interviews with various practitioners and Maltese lawyers, who give their respective views and recommendations regarding current and prospective financial assistance law in Malta. | en_GB |
